What does a Recreation Aide do?- Implements recreation programs which include activities such as outings, parties, exercises, crafts and entertainment.
- Organizes resident activities and trips outside the facility while ensuring that the residents have proper clothing and necessary equipment for the activity, confirms details of the proposed activity with nursing/administration staff, coordinates the movement of residents during the activity and teaches the techniques of the related activity.
- Consults with family and nursing staff in order to determine the activities which meet the residents’ needs.
- Designs an appropriate variety of recreation programs tailored to resident needs.
- Monitors and evaluates resident progress through activity programs and reports observations such as emotional wellbeing and social behavior to nursing staff as required.
- Maintains Inventory of equipment, tools and materials and reports malfunctioning equipment and supply needs to the appropriate staff.
Qualifications:- Graduate from a recognized Activity/Recreation Certificate or diploma program.
- Experience in a senior’s focused recreation department an asset.
- Health Care Provider level First Aid Certificate (Current).
- Proof of COVID vaccination.
About us: Point Grey Private Hospital is located in Vancouver’s ocean-side community of Kitsilano.Point Grey, significantly expanded and improved in 2020, offers 153 licensed residential care beds consisting of primarily single occupancy rooms.
Point Grey boasts views of the mountains and ocean as well as large windows and homelike furnishings. This home has four stories with a dining area, recreation areas and a large outdoor patio on each floor. The desirable location and freshly decorated interior provides our clients with a comfortable and homelike environment.
Point Grey Private Hospital works in collaboration with the Vancouver Coastal Health Authority to offer funded beds but also has five private pay rooms available.
